Konami is entering the desktop PC business – PC Gamer AU
Two Arespear models will start shipping in September.

The division responsible for Konami’s famed pachinko machines is diving into a new market: PC gaming. Japanese outlet PC Watch (via Tom’s Hardware) reports that the company has three desktop models currently available to preorder, with shipping due to commence this September.
The Arespear product line is handled by Konami Amusements, which also handles arcade systems and the company’s esports interests. The models range from 184,000 yen (roughly $1,750 in the US) through to 338,800 yen ($3,205)…
